diff options
Diffstat (limited to 'bsps/arm/atsam/include/libchip/include/xdmad.h')
-rw-r--r-- | bsps/arm/atsam/include/libchip/include/xdmad.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/bsps/arm/atsam/include/libchip/include/xdmad.h b/bsps/arm/atsam/include/libchip/include/xdmad.h index 97e24c880b..cba3d052ab 100644 --- a/bsps/arm/atsam/include/libchip/include/xdmad.h +++ b/bsps/arm/atsam/include/libchip/include/xdmad.h @@ -241,6 +241,10 @@ extern eXdmadRC XDMAD_StartTransfer(sXdmad *pXdmad, uint32_t dwChannel); extern void XDMAD_DoNothingCallback(uint32_t Channel, void *pArg, uint32_t status); +extern bool XDMAD_UpdateStatusFromCallback(sXdmad *pXdmad, + uint32_t Channel, + uint32_t status); + extern eXdmadRC XDMAD_SetCallback(sXdmad *pXdmad, uint32_t dwChannel, XdmadTransferCallback fCallback, |